On my EA account I had two personas/gamertags. I requested an advisor to remove one persona and move it into another EA account, so I would have only one persona at my main account.

 

After doing this, I was unable to use the Web App/Companion App on my main account with the persona that was not moved. I understand that the second persona which was moved would have its progress reset, but the advisor confirmed me that the persona which was not moved would remain untouched.

 

Already used the support chat two times, advisors confirmed that there are no issues with my account and already attempted several things like waiting for the servers two update (already waited around 72 hours), changing my password, reinstalling the companion app, log in to the web app on different browsers/ips and cleaning cache. None has worked so they have told me that this is a bug which should be reported here.

 

This is the error:

Login Unavailable We’re currently having trouble with login services. While we work on it, you can try to log in from your Console or PC to get the full FUT experience.
